" THE PROPERTY A spacious light and airy semi-detached house understood to have been built circa.1938 and offering well presented accommodation which has been maintained and improved over the years and provides a generously proportioned family home. On the ground floor with recently refurbished side porch, a spacious central reception hall and staircase, incorporating period panelled doors, a generous size dual aspect lounge to the front, a large dining room with patio doors to the rear garden and a spacious fitted kitchen/breakfast room of dual aspect to the side and overlooking the rear garden. At first floor level a wide light and airy galleried landing with access to a large loft, three good size bedrooms, a bathroom and separate wc. \r \rThe property stands on a generous size rectangular shaped plot having a long private drive providing off street parking and with a garage set to the rear. The property itself set back and slightly elevated above the road by the front garden and to the rear a good size enclosed south westerly facing back garden. From the rear garden a gate with direct access opening onto the adjoining amenity parkland known as Collings Park.  LOCATION Set in this prime popular established residential area of Higher Compton occupying a pleasant and enviable position here on this side of the street having a longer back garden and sunny rear aspect. Higher Compton provides for a good variety of local services and amenities and the position is convenient for access into the city and close by connection to major routes in other directions.  Front door with double glazed decorated light opens into:  GROUND FLOOR   ENTRANCE PORCH 5' 8" x 4' 7" (1.73m x 1.4m) Re-built with new metal supports and uPVC double glazed windows on two sides.
